The East starring Brit Marling, Alexander Skarsgård, Elliot Page, Toby Kebbell has a PG-13 rating, a runtime of about 1 hr 56 min. The release date of the movie is May 31st, 2013. The movie received a user score of 65/100 on TMDb, which reflects reviews from 807 community users.
Curious about the story behind it? Here's the plot: "An operative for an elite private intelligence firm finds her priorities irrevocably changed after she is tasked with infiltrating an anarchist group known for executing covert attacks upon major corporations."
